Elon Musk’s latest effort to show off Starlink’s ability to operate in the air and his gaming prowess turned bitter as he became the laughing stock of the internet after a livestream of Path of Exile 2 on his personal jet.

The billionaire, who streamed live on X on Saturday, referred to it as an “airborne continuity test” of Starlink, his satellite internet business. But, as The Mirror said, the broadcast soon turned into a deluge of criticism at Musk’s political views, his personal life, and his corporate choices — from layoffs to support for Donald Trump.

As reported by The Verge, Musk quietly went through the first few stages of the game, dying over and over and resetting with fresh characters. His acting didn’t do anything to mitigate the situation, as observers swooped on his repeated deaths. Interestingly, Musk has earlier confessed to paying for engagement boosts on his page.

Bullying During Live Stream

Shortly after the stream started, the bullying commenced. One user requested, “Can you pls j**k off mr trump so he has a heart attack. [sic]” That was only the start.

“You have no actual friends and will die alone,” one viewer wrote. Another read, “You will always feel insecure and it will never go away.”

“Ruined the country just like you ruined all your marriages,” added someone, and another user jeered at his company: “Elon how is it possible to look so dumb and ugly why is ur Tesla company falling apart? [sic]”

One gamer, impersonating conservative commentator Ashley St Clair, quipped: “Elon. It’s me, Ashley St Claire. I have no other way of reaching you so I just purchased PoE2 early access just for this. Please pay your child support. Thank you Elon,” and continued to repeat the message through the stream.

Though some users attempted to guide Musk through the game and turn off the chat function, their efforts were drowned out by the torrent of trolling.

Despite the harassment, Musk remained for the most part quiet. When he did, he replied to one with, “There’s a lot of r—–s in the chat.” Shortly later, after his character died a third time, Musk suddenly closed the stream due to ‘connection was lost’.
